System requirements

Windows
Minimum
Operating system (OS)
Processor (CPU) 2.0 GHz or higher
System memory (RAM) 2 GB
Hard disk drive (HDD) 200 MB
Video card (GPU) 500 MB of VRAM
DirectX 9.0c compatible
Shader model 2.0 support
